Abstract
In the paper, to improve the signal detection performance in an oceanic reverberation environment, the algorithm based on whiten filter, beamforming, and mathematical morphology from image processing was presented as well as the parameters selection method of the detector. The result of an oceanic experimentation presents that the algorithm does improve the performance in the oceanic reverberation background. Especially, in the processed beam image, the target is very distinct. Comparing with single traditional anti-reverberation method, the algorithm fully utilizes the temporal and spatial difference between detection signal and reverberation to optimize the localization and detection.
